What does an Entry Level Business Relationship Manager do?

An Entry Level Business Relationship Manager is responsible for building and maintaining positive relationships between a company and its clients or business partners. Their tasks typically include understanding client needs, assisting with client onboarding, resolving issues, and supporting account management teams. They often act as a liaison to ensure effective communication, help identify opportunities for business growth, and contribute to customer satisfaction. This role is ideal for those who enjoy working with people and are interested in business development.

How to get into business relationship management?

To enter business relationship management, candidates typically need a bachelor's degree in business, marketing, or related fields, along with strong communication and interpersonal skills. Gaining experience in customer service, sales, or account management can be helpful, and certifications like the Certified Business Relationship Manager (CBRM) can enhance prospects. Developing knowledge of industry tools and CRM software also supports entry into this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Entry Level Business Relationship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level Business Relationship Manager, you typically need a bachelor’s degree in business or a related field, strong analytical abilities, and foundational knowledge of relationship management principles. Familiarity with CRM software (such as Salesforce), Microsoft Office Suite, and basic data analysis tools is commonly required. Excellent interpersonal, active listening, and problem-solving skills help you build trust and effectively address client needs. These competencies are crucial for supporting client satisfaction, fostering long-term partnerships, and contributing to organizational growth.

What is the difference between Entry Level Business Relationship Manager vs Customer Service Representative?

AspectEntry Level Business Relationship ManagerCustomer Service Representative
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ree, basic knowledge of business and communication skillsHigh school diploma or equivalent, customer service skills
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, client meetings, account managementCall centers, retail, or service desks
Employer & Industry UsageFinancial services, consulting, corporate sectorsRetail, telecommunications, hospitality
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ding entry-level roles in client relationship managementCustomer support and service roles

The Entry Level Business Relationship Manager focuses on building and maintaining client relationships, often involving account management and strategic communication. In contrast, Customer Service Representatives primarily handle customer inquiries, support, and issue resolution. While both roles require strong communication skills, the Business Relationship Manager role typically involves a broader understanding of business operations and client needs, making it suitable for those seeking to grow into client management careers.

Position Summary

The Business Relationship Manager is part of a team who manages a portfolio of business clients. The team’s three primary objectives are:

  • Provide exceptional customer service by helping identify a client’s needs and then matching them with products and services offered by Heritage Bank.
  • Maintain a sound credit culture that consists of quality underwriting and on-going monitoring of the portfolio.
  • Grow our market share.


The Business Relationship Manager plays a large role in growing the portfolio. The Business Relationship Manager meets with our existing clients to identify needs that they have and matches them with the products and services that are offered by Heritage Bank. The Business Relationship Manager is also responsible for expanding our client base by soliciting new businesses and discussing ways that Heritage Bank can help them succeed.


Proving quality customer service is a must for the Business Relationship Manager. This involves regular visits and correspondence with our existing clients, timely follow-up to issues that arise and adding value for the customer in your interactions.


A solid understanding of the products and services that Heritage Bank offers as well as alternative lending programs (SBA 7(a), SBA 504, FSA and other gap financing programs) is essential to be successful. A thorough knowledge of appropriate credit structuring is also a must.
